摘要
偏振控制器在高速光纤通信、相干光纤通信以及光纤传感等领域具有十分重要的作用,它是克服光传输系统中偏振相关损耗和监测仪器偏振特性的关键元件。本文在阐述偏振控制器工作原理的基础上,重点介绍了几种新的偏振控制器实现方案,并对各种偏振控制器的性能进行了分析比较。
Polarization controllers are very important in the high - speed optical fiber communication systems, coherent optical fiber communication systems and fiber optic sensor systems, which is an essential part to overcome the polarization correlation loss of fiberoptic transmission system and to monitor the polarization characteristics of the fiber communication instrument. This paper presents principles of polarization controllers, introduces with emphasis on several new kinds of polarization controllers proposed recently, and compares the performance of each kind of polarization controllers.
